Modelling the evolution of genetic regulatory networks

Summary

This study introduces an Artificial Genome (AG) model to simulate the evolution of genetic regulatory networks. The AG model generates gene networks with properties between random and scale-free networks, revealing biases towards evolving cyclic gene expression patterns.
